Get lost in patterns and geometric shapes for a modern twist on traditional rock painting. These designs are easy to recreate and can be incredibly visually striking.
For an elegant touch, paint your rocks with stripes, geometric patterns, or a bold marbled effect. You can even recreate trendy wall art or tile designs on a smaller scale.









To create stripped rocks, paint thin, even stripes in contrasting or complementary colors. For a more striking design, try out alternating colors or use different widths for a fun, eclectic look.
Geometric designs can include everything from triangles and hexagons to complex mandalas. Start with sketching your design on paper, then transfer it onto your rock using a light-box or a pencil transferred with rubbing alcohol.
Create beautiful, swirling patterns on your rocks that resemble luxurious marble. Start by applying a base coat of a lighter color. Then, use a toothpick or a pin to drizzle different colors of paint onto the wet base.
Once you've created your marbled effect, use a soft brush to gently swirl the colors together. Allow the paint to dry, then lightly sand the surface to smooth out any rough edges. Finally, seal your creation with a clear-drying varnish.
